Vintage travel shield charms have become highly appreciated as miniature pieces of art.
It's cheap and rather easy to build an interesting collection of these tiny beauties.
This particular charm from Mals (local name) or Malles Venosta (Italian name) is very rare due to the misspelling "Males". See the fourth picture above for verification of the spelling error. It is of course impossible to know how many charms the manufacturer produced with this error but he probably only did it once ...
The charm is in a very good condition excactly as when I bought it myself in 1967.
I have kept it in my jewelry box and never worn the charm but as silver is rather soft,
some tiny scratches are inevitable on the backside because more charms were kept in the same box.
The enamel front side is absolutely perfect - no scratches nor other damages there.
Details: 800 Silver with enamel. Original oval jump ring for easy mounting included.
Please note that enamel travel shield charms are rather small. See the picture with measures.
Approx. size: Height 5/8" x Width 1/2" (11 mm x 16 mm) +the jump ring.
The weight is approx. 3.5 grams.
